Hi. This is an anomalous (in my opinion) behavior of the "mouseWithin" message. >From the dictionary:
Note: If there is no mouseWithin handler in the target object's script, no mouseWithin message is sent, even if there is a mouseWithin handler in an object that's further along the message path. Why this should be so is a mystery, but maybe someone from the team will chime in.
